The table below lists every degree level available for chemical engineering at Vanderbilt University, along with how many graduates complete each level annually.
| Degree Level | Annual Graduates |
|---|---|
| Bachelor’s | 24 |
| Master’s | 4 |
| Doctoral | 10 |
During the most recent reporting year, Vanderbilt University awarded 24 bachelor’s degrees in chemical engineering.

Chemical Engineering majors who earn their bachelor’s degree from Vanderbilt University report a median salary of $96,178 a year. This is below $102,170, the median for all majors at Vanderbilt University.
Average full-time tuition and fees are listed in the table below.
| In State | Out of State | |
|---|---|---|
| Tuition | $54,840 | $65,008 |
| Fees | $2,490 | $2,490 |

In the most recent graduating class, 42% of chemical engineering bachelor’s degrees went to men and 58% went to women.
The majority of chemical engineering bachelor’s degree graduates at Vanderbilt University were White. Roughly 62%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Vanderbilt University with a bachelor’s in chemical engineering.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 3 |
| Black or African American | 0 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 3 |
| White | 15 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
| Other Races | 3 |
